Basket worm Meaning, Definition & Usage

Definitions
  1. (Zoöl.), a lepidopterous insect of the genus Thyridopteryx and allied genera, esp. T. ephemeræformis. The larva makes and carries about a bag or basket-like case of silk and twigs, which it afterwards hangs up to shelter the pupa and wingless adult females.

Webster 1913